While Woodgrange Park may not boast an extensive range of amenities, it does provide essential services to ensure a comfortable travel experience. Tickets can be easily purchased and collected from on-site machines, which are accessible to all travelers, including those with disabilities. For those with hearing impairments, the induction loop system allows for smoother communication. However, travelers should note the absence of refreshment facilities and waiting lounges, so planning ahead is suggested if you're in need of a snack or a place to rest before your journey.
The station takes pride in its step-free access, creating an inclusive environment for travelers of all capabilities. CCTV cameras cover both the bicycle storage area and the station to ensure passenger safety. Regrettably, there are no available accessible taxis or parking spaces specifically designated for those with mobility impairments, so it may be wise to plan accordingly if special arrangements are needed. Fortunately, trained staff are present to offer on-the-spot assistance and general inquiries seven days a week, ensuring your journey with the Overground is as smooth as possible.

For those planning their travel from Southall, the station provides an assortment of facilities to ensure a seamless experience. The ticket office operates from 06:30 to 19:30 on weekdays and Saturdays, with shorter hours on Sundays from 08:10 to 15:30. Ticket machines are available for collecting pre-booked tickets, making it a breeze to manage your travel plans.
Accessibility is a priority at Southall Station, where you'll find step-free access to all platforms, making it easy for individuals with mobility challenges to navigate the station. Additionally, staff ramp assistance and wheelchairs are on hand throughout the day to offer further support. The station offers accessible ticket machines and induction loops to ensure everyone can travel with ease and independence.
If you need to freshen up before your journey, Southall has you covered with male, female, and accessible toilets. Baby changing facilities are also available for families traveling with little ones. While there may not be refreshment facilities or shops directly within the station, the vibrant locale just beyond the station doors offers plenty of options for dining and shopping.
In terms of connectivity, Southall provides numerous links to alternative transportation for those seeking onward travel. Nearby bus services operated by Transport for London offer easy access across the city, with routes and schedules available to plan your journey further. If you're heading towards Heathrow Airport, the Elizabeth Line provides direct service; alternatively, you can take the 482 bus for a hassle-free trip.
